Final Doom

Final Doom is a first-person shooter video game that uses the game engine, items and characters from Doom II: Hell on Earth and was released in 1996 and distributed as an official id Software product.

Final Doom consists of two 32-level megawads (level files), The Plutonia Experiment by the Casali brothers, and TNT: Evilution by TeamTNT. In addition to the PC versions, Final Doom was also released for the PlayStation; that version included a selection of Final Doom and Master Levels for Doom II levels combined into one game.
